Retouch4me Clean Backdrop is an AI-driven plugin and standalone application designed to automatically remove dirt, sensor dust, small folds, and scratches from studio backgrounds. Reviewers generally consider it one of the most effective time-saving tools in the Retouch4me suite, especially for high-volume studio photographers. Key Performance Highlights

Intelligent Subject Protection: The "Automask" feature effectively identifies the subject, ensuring the background cleaning doesn't accidentally blur or alter the person or product.

Preservation of Realism: Unlike simple color fills, it maintains original shadows and gradients, keeping the final image looking natural rather than like a flat digital replacement.

Granular Control: It offers three scale modes—Fine, Medium, and Coarse—to target different sizes of background imperfections. retouch4me clean backdrop 1012zip upd

Live Model Support: When connected to the internet, it can use a "Live Model" to download the most up-to-date and accurate neural network for processing. Common Criticisms & Limitations

Potential for Over-Smoothing: At 100% opacity or in "Coarse" mode, it can sometimes make backdrops look unnaturally perfect or plastic. Experts from The Phoblographer recommend using it at lower opacity for a more realistic finish.

Software Stability: Some users reported that the Clean Backdrop plugin is more prone to crashing than other Retouch4me tools, particularly on very busy or complex images.

Lack of Bulk Options in Plugin Mode: While the standalone app supports batch processing, the Photoshop plugin typically requires running it on images individually unless a custom Photoshop Action is created.

Price: At roughly $124–$149 per individual plugin, it is a significant investment for those who do not process high volumes of studio work. Workflow Tips

Opacity is Key: Running the plugin on a separate layer in Photoshop allows you to dial back the opacity to find the sweet spot between "clean" and "natural".

Use Standalone for Speed: If you have hundreds of photos from a single session, the Retouch4me Standalone App is much faster for batch cleaning than the Photoshop plugin.

2. Performance & Usability

  • Ease of Use: It is incredibly simple. You install the plugin, open your image in Photoshop, run the plugin, and let the AI process it. There are very few sliders—usually just a "Sensitivity" or "Opacity" slider.
  • Speed: The processing is fast (usually taking 5–15 seconds depending on your GPU). It is significantly faster than manually using the Clone Stamp or Healing Brush tools to patch up a dirty floor.
  • Integration: It works as a standard Photoshop plugin (and sometimes as a standalone app), fitting easily into a professional workflow.
